In September 2022, annual inflation rate amounted to 11.5% in Georgia

03.10.22 11:40


In September 2022 the Consumer Price Index increased by 0.8 percent compared to the previous month, while the annual inflation rate amounted to 11.5 percent, National Statistics Office of Georgia (Geostat) reports.

 

According to Geostat, with regard to the annual core inflation, the prices increased by 7.5 percent, while the annual core inflation without tobacco also amounted to 7.5 percent.

 

"The monthly inflation rate was mainly influenced by price changes for the following groups: Food and non-alcoholic beverages: the prices for the group increased by 1.7 percent, contributing 0.62 percentage points to the overall monthly inflation rate. The prices increased for the following subgroups: vegetables (7.6 percent), milk, cheese and eggs (4.6 percent), mineral waters, soft drinks, fruit and vegetable juices (2.3 percent), fruit and grapes (2.0 percent), fish (1.4 percent). At the same time, prices decreased for the following subgroups: sugar, jam, honey, chocolate and confectionery (-1.4 percent), oils and fats (-1.1 percent); Education: the prices for the group increased by 7.5 percent, contributing 0.32 percentage points to the overall index. The prices increased for the following subgroups: secondary education (11.6 percent), education not definable by level (8.6 percent), pre-primary and primary education (6.1 percent); Health: the prices for the group decreased by 2.0 percent, contributing -0.18 percentage points to the overall index. Within the group, the prices were lower for medical products, appliances and equipment (-3.6 percent); Transport: the prices for the group decreased by 1.3 percent, contributing -0.15 percentage points to the overall index. Within the group the prices decreased for operation of personal transport equipment (-1.6 percent).

 

The annual inflation rate was mainly influenced by price changes for the following groups: Food and non-alcoholic beverages: the prices in the group increased by 17.6 percent, contributing 5.74 percentage points to the overall annual inflation rate. Within the group the prices increased for the following subgroups: bread and cereals (32.8 percent), milk, cheese and eggs (23.3 percent), mineral waters, soft drinks, fruit and vegetable juices (22.5 percent), oils and fats (21.2 percent), coffee, tea and cocoa (18.9 percent), fish (16.5 percent), sugar, jam, honey, chocolate and confectionery (15.8 percent), meat (9.8 percent), fruit and grapes (9.6 percent); Transport: the prices in the group increased by 14.1 percent, contributing 1.69 percentage points to the overall index. Within the group the prices increased for operation of personal transport equipment (16.8 percent) and transport services (13.7 percent); Housing, water, electricity, gas and other fuels: the prices for the group posted a 12.2 percent increase, which contributed 1.18 percentage points to the annual inflation rate. The prices were higher for the following subgroups: actual rentals for housing (24.3 percent), maintenance and repair of the dwelling (12.5 percent), electricity, gas and other fuels (5.8 percent)," reads the report.
